Ir para conteúdo
  • Cadastre-se

dev botao

  • Este tópico foi criado há 2032 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Introdução:
    Recebemos gentilmente da Control iD, o SAT S@T-iD, para testes. Utilizando o exemplo do ACBr: SATTeste.exe.
image.png

Ambiente:

Computador Notebook Dell
Sistema Operacional Windows 10 64Bit atualizado (24/04/2018)
Processador Intel i3-3217U 1.80GHz
Memória 4 GB
USB 2.0

 

SAT S@T-iD
Certificados AC-SAT
Rede 2 portas 10/100 em modo bridge


Instalação do SAT:
    Não houve a necessidade de instalar os drivers do SAT no Windows 10. Bastou conectá-lo ao computador e o Windows fez a instalação automaticamente:
image.png


Software de Ativação:
    O software de ativação e o manual estão disponíveis neste link: https://www.controlid.com.br/automacao-comercial/satid/

Instalação:
    Software de ativação: https://www.controlid.com.br/suporte/satid/satid-setup.exe
    Para realizar a instalação siga as etapas abaixo:

  • Realize o download do software de ativação
  • Com o usuário administrador, execute o instalador satid-setup.exe;
  • Durante os passos da instalação, altere as informações conforme as suas necessidades. Em nosso ambiente mantivemos o padrão:
    image.png


Configuração de rede:
    Para configurar a rede siga os passos abaixo:

  1. Na inicialização do Ativador será exibido uma tela de boas vindas, selecione a opção SAT Ativado(1) e clique em Pular(2);
  2. Digite o código de ativação(3) para liberar o uso do Ativador. Em nosso ambiente de testes o Cód. de ativação é senha12345.
  3. Clique em Salvar(4)
    image.png
     
  4. Selecione Configurar Rede(5) e configure de acordo com o seu ambiente. Em nosso caso mantivemos a configuração de fábrica, ou seja, como DHCP(6).
  5. Clique em Configurar(7);
    image.png
     
  6. Para verificar se as configurações foram aplicadas, clique em Status Operacional(8) e verifique os campos de informações da rede, principalmente LAN_IP e LAN_GW(9);
    image.png


Ativação:
    O SAT que temos em mãos é destinado a ambientes de desenvolvimento, ou seja, SDK. Por padrão, um SAT SDK é ativado de fábrica. Disponibilizamos abaixo os dados para uso do SAT S@T-iD em um ambiente de desenvolvimento:

  • Código de ativação: senha12345
  • CNPJ do contribuinte: 08238299000129
  • Inscrição Estadual do contribuinte: 149392863111
  • CNPJ da Software House : 16716114000172
  • Assinatura da Software House: SGR-SAT SISTEMA DE GESTAO E RETAGUARDA DO SAT

    Caso o seu SAT não seja de desenvolvimento, você pode ativá-lo preenchendo as informações de ativação conforme os passos abaixo:

  1. Clique em Ativar SAT(1) ==> Ativar(2?
    image.png
     
  2. Em seguida, associar a assinatura em Associar a Assinatura(3) ==> Associar(4):
    image.png

    Obs.: Em caso de dúvidas, o manual do fabricante deverá ser consultado.

 

Testes usando os componentes e Demos do ACBr:
    Com o componente ACBrSAT, parte do projeto ACBr, podemos agregar todas as funcionalidades disponíveis no ativador do fabricante em um software particular. Para demonstrar tais funcionalidades utilizamos o SATTeste.exe, demo do ACBrSAT. O SATTeste.exe está disponível neste link: https://www.projetoacbr.com.br/forum/files/file/316-sattesteexe/

    Definimos as configurações desta forma:
Aba Configuração:
image.png

  • Inicialização: satDinamico_cdecl
  • Nome DLL: C:\SAT\dlls\ControliD\libsatidlib.dll (Veja a Nota logo abaixo)
  • Ambiente: taHomologacao
  • Código de Ativação: senha12345
  • Remover Acentos: Desabilitado
  • Página de Código: 65001
  • UTF8: Habilitado
  • Demais opções não alteramos.

    Nota: A DLL encontra-se disponível neste link: https://www.controlid.com.br/suporte/satid/sat_dll.zip

Aba Dados Emitente:
image.png

  • CNPJ: 08238299000129
  • Insc.Estadual: 149392863111
  • Demais opções não alteramos

Aba Dados Sw.House:
image.png

  • CNPJ: 16716114000172
  • Assinatura Sw.House: SGR-SAT SISTEMA DE GESTAO E RETAGUARDA DO SAT

Aba Rede:
image.png

  • Tipo Rede: ETHE (rede cabeada)
  • Tipo Rede: DHCP

    Para aplicar as configurações de rede, clique em Inicializar(1) ==> Configurações(2) ==> Configurar Interface Rede(3). O retorno deverá ser Rede Configurada com Sucesso(4?
image.png


Ativar SAT:
    Clique em Ativação(1) ==> Ativar SAT(2). Verifique a resposta no Log de Comandos. Em nosso caso o SAT já está ativado(3?
image.png
 

Associar a assinatura:
    Clique em Ativação(1) ==> Associar Assinatura(2). Verifique se a assinatura foi registrada(3)
image.png


Status operacional:
    Para confirmar se as etapas Ativar SAT e Associar a assinatura funcionam, clique em Consultas(1) ==> Consultar Status Operacional(2). Verifique a resposta no Log de Comandos(3?
image.png


Teste de desempenho:
    Utilizando o SATTeste, realizamos vendas com diferentes quantidades de itens. Para cada quantidade foram emitidas 10 vendas, medido o tempo de cada uma e calculado o tempo médio. O tempo foi medido do envio da venda ao recebimento do xml, não esta sendo contabilizado o tempo de decodificação do XML de recebimento. Todos os testes foram registrados na tabela abaixo:
image.png
                * Quantidade máxima de itens em uma venda com o SAT é de 500. Acima dessa quantidade o SAT retorna “Erro não identificado”, o tempo calculado neste caso foi o retorno do erro. O tempo do retorno do erro não foi calculado na média total.
                Nota: O tempo medido nesse teste, é computado desde o início da transmissão do XML para o SAT, até a recepção do XML de venda, gerado como resposta pelo SAT. Ou seja, é uma medição diferente do que a Especificação Técnica do SAT preconiza, onde apenas o tempo de Geração do XML da venda é considerado.

Sobre o equipamento:
    O S@T-iD chama a atenção pela aparência. Seu design é moderno, quebrando o formato “caixa quadrada” - aspecto comum na maioria dos SATs disponíveis no mercado. Ele também é pequeno, quase a metade de um SAT convencional. As luzes acompanham o layout do gabinete, informando de uma forma sutil o seu status.
    Na traseira do gabinete ficam as conexões de rede, energia via micro USB e o botão reset.
    As conexões de rede funcionam em modo “bridge” permitindo compartilhar o mesmo ponto de rede para o SAT e o computador.

 

Sobre a utilização do equipamento:
    O S@T-iD se comportou no estilo “Plug-N-Play”, ou seja, bastou conectá-lo no computador e em poucos segundos o SAT estava pronto para uso no Windows 10.
    Durante o uso, ele funcionou de forma satisfatória. Não houveram travamentos ou lentidões.
    Ele não suporta rede com proxy.

 

Ficha técnica fornecida pelo fabricante:

  • Modelo: S@T-iD
  • Funcionalidades: Emissão de Cupom Fiscal Eletrônico atendendo aos requisitos dos projetos SAT-CF-e
  • Certificados Digitais: Suporta somente certificados do tipo AC-SAT
  • Memória Interna: 1GB
  • Interface de Rede: 02 x Ethernet 802.3 10/100 Mbps full-duplex
  • Interface USB: 01 x USB 2.0 compatível 1.1
  • Bateria Interna: Alimenta Relógio Interno e Memória de Segurança >= 5 anos
  • Sinalizações: 08 LEDs de indicação
  • Dimensões: 36.5 mm x 90 mm x 96.9 mm (AxLxP)
  • Peso: 100g
  • Alimentação: USB 5V/500mA
  • Botão Reset: Desativar o SAT e voltar as configurações de fábrica


Amostras:
    Disponibilizamos abaixo os XMLs de uma venda e seu cancelamento:

    O extrato de venda(esquerda) e de cancelamento(direita) impressos:
image.png

image.png

  • Curtir 8
  • Obrigado 3
Link para o comentário
Compartilhar em outros sites

×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.